Postsecondary Psychology Teacher Salary in Salisbury, Maryland

The annual salary statistics of postsecondary psychology teachers in Salisbury, Maryland is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of postsecondary psychology teachers in Salisbury is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Postsecondary Psychology Teachers in Salisbury, Maryland

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$34,250
25th Percentile Wage
$39,320
50th Percentile Wage
$62,250
75th Percentile Wage
$90,650
90th Percentile Wage
$139,450

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for postsecondary psychology teachers in Salisbury, Maryland in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$139,450.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$62,250.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$34,250.

Table 2. Compare Postsecondary Psychology Teacher Salary in Salisbury with Other Maryland Cities

From Table 3 we note that with a median annual salary of $62,250, Salisbury is the lowest paying city for postsecondary psychology teachers in state of Maryland, following city of Baltimore-Towson (median annual salary of $78,610). Also we note that in comparison, the annual salary of postsecondary psychology teachers in Salisbury is about 20.8 percent (20.8%) lower than that of the highest paying city Baltimore-Towson.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Baltimore-Towson
$78,610
Bethesda-Rockville-Frederick
$68,880
Salisbury
$62,250
